CALPADS rule: If Student Exit Reason Code equals E230 Completer Exit, Student School Completion Status Code must be populated.
Severity: Fatal Type: Input Validation
Fields validated:
- 1.26 Student Exit Reason Code
- 1.27 Student School Completion Status Code
There are only two legitimate pathways. If a documented completion event occurred, retain E230 and populate the supported current completion status. If the student did not complete an academic program or the highest grade offered, replace E230 with the accurate current exit reason and leave Completion Status blank. Never select a status merely to fill the field.
Current completion-status choices for Version 18
| Code | Completion outcome | Evidence question |
|---|---|---|
100 | Graduated with a standard high school diploma | Was the standard diploma actually awarded after all applicable requirements were met? |
102 | Alternative Diploma Pathway | Was the student eligible for and awarded the defined alternative diploma? |
120 | Student with disabilities certificate of completion | Does disability status and the awarded certificate support this precise outcome? |
250 | Adult Education high school diploma | Was the diploma awarded through the qualifying Adult Education program? |
320 | High school equivalency certificate, without a standard high school diploma | Is the equivalency credential documented, and was no standard diploma earned? |
330 | California Certificate of Proficiency, without a standard high school diploma | Is the California proficiency credential documented, and was no standard diploma earned? |
360 | Completed Grade 12 without completing graduation requirements; not a graduate | Does the final transcript/graduation audit confirm Grade 12 completion but no graduation? |
480 | Promoted or matriculated to a California public school after completing the highest grade offered | Did the student finish the school’s highest grade and move to another California public school? |
485 | Promoted or matriculated to an out-of-California public school after completing the highest grade offered | Did the student finish the highest grade offered and move to a public school outside California? |
Choose between completing E230 and replacing E230
| What the evidence shows | Correct response | What not to do |
|---|---|---|
| A standard diploma was awarded | Retain E230 and report 100. | Use 100 because graduation was merely expected. |
| A different current credential/outcome occurred | Retain E230 and select the exact supported status from the Version 18 table. | Default every completer to 100. |
| Grade 12 ended without graduation | Determine whether documented facts support E230 + 360 or a different exit event. | Treat 360 as a diploma. |
| Student completed the highest grade offered and matriculated | Use 480 or 485 according to the public-school destination. | Use a routine year-end exit without evaluating the matriculation outcome. |
| Student transferred before completing the program/grade | Replace E230 with the supported current transfer/exit reason; leave field 1.27 blank. | Invent a completion status to preserve an incorrect E230. |
| Completion remains pending or unverified | Resolve the authoritative student record before reporting a completion outcome. | Report a projected credential as already earned. |
The completion status must also fit the grade
| Check | Why it matters | Example concern |
|---|---|---|
| Grade Level Code | Completion statuses have their own permitted grade combinations. | A status may pair with E230 but still fail against the student’s grade. |
| School grade span | Codes 480/485 require completion of the highest grade offered. | A Grade 5 student at a K–8 school has not completed that school’s highest grade. |
| Destination | 480 and 485 distinguish California from out-of-California public schools. | A private-school destination does not match either label merely because the student was promoted. |
| Credential actually awarded | Codes 100, 102, 120, 250, 320, and 330 describe different outcomes. | A certificate, equivalency, proficiency credential, and diploma are not interchangeable. |
| Exit Date | The enrollment must end on the supported completion event date. | Do not use the ceremony date or data-entry date when it differs from the effective completion/exit date. |
What commonly produces SENR0029
| What you find | Likely cause | Durable correction |
|---|---|---|
E230 exists; field 1.27 is blank in SIS | The completion workflow allowed an incomplete event. | Verify the outcome and complete or reverse the event; enforce paired fields locally. |
| Status exists in SIS but not in SENR file | The extract omitted, filtered, or mis-mapped field 1.27. | Repair the report/integration and test the complete completer population. |
Every year-end student received E230 | Bulk rollover treated advancement or withdrawal as completion. | Separate ordinary year-end, Grade 12 continuation, completion, and highest-grade matriculation logic. |
| Expected graduates have blank status | E230 was assigned before final outcomes were available. | Report completion only after authoritative evidence establishes the result. |
| Elementary/middle completers are blank | Staff assumed completion statuses apply only to high school. | Evaluate 480/485 when the student completed the highest grade offered and matriculated. |
| Local status cannot be translated | The SIS crosswalk is incomplete or obsolete. | Map each documented local outcome to a current CALPADS status and retire historical mappings. |
| Manual entry clears the error temporarily | The authoritative SIS still lacks field 1.27. | Correct the source and confirm the next extract reproduces the accepted pair. |

Recommended correction path
Preserve the rejected row
Capture submission ID, SSID, school, enrollment key, grade, Exit Date, and exact fields 1.26 and 1.27.
Confirm the intended enrollment
Match the row to the correct SIS segment and existing CALPADS history.
Determine whether E230 is factual
Distinguish documented completion/highest-grade matriculation from transfer, continuation, or another exit.
Identify the authoritative outcome
Use transcript, audit, awarded credential, disability documentation, or matriculation evidence.
Select the current status
Choose one of the nine Version 18 statuses that precisely describes the outcome.
Validate connected fields
Confirm Grade Level, school grade span, destination, Exit Date, and surrounding enrollment chronology.
Correct the owning system
Repair the SIS event, local crosswalk, required-field rule, or extract mapping.
Submit and verify
Confirm SENR0029 clears and CALPADS displays the intended completion outcome.
Review the shared population
Find other
E230records missing status, especially those sharing the same school, grade, workflow, or extract.
